Holy Bible Poetry is a book of 176 poems, each of which includes a popular Biblical passage word for word. A limited number of additional words and phrases are inserted in and around the passage to produce a rhyming poem with consistent timing and meter. The additions are intended to clarify or enhance the message as well. From Genesis through Revelation, 46 of the 66 books in the Bible are represented by at least one poem. Examples include Genesis 1: 1-2 (In the Beginning), Psalm 23 (The Lord Is My Shepherd), Matthew 17: 20 (Grain of Mustard Seed), Luke 6: 27-29 (Love Your Enemies) with 172 other popular passages/poems.

Presenting the Truths of the Bible in a Contemporary, Engaging Style With over 300 Inspirational Rhymes The author, Simon Siewsaran, is the Founder and Senior Pastor of the Everlasting Gospel Church (established in 1997), a vibrant community ministry, located at Enterprise, Trinidad. Pastor Siewsaran is also the host of "Don't Give Up," a popular radio broadcast that began in 2001 and is heard throughout Trinidad & Tobago and the southern Caribbean. His early years in ministry were primarily among delinquent youths, including drug addicts, and during this time was himself the target of numerous molestations from fellow villagers. Yet signs and wonders continue to follow this servant of God who has impacted thousands of lives in honour of the Kingdom. His effervescent, lyrical style of preaching endears him to both young and old; and his anointed ministry extends beyond his pastoral duties, most notably as the President of "Touch T&T Ministries," a para-church organization that conducts national events, including crusades, concerts and prayer assemblies. Pastor Siewsaran's missionary trips include the Holy Land - three occasions - Egypt, England, Holland, USA and the Caribbean islands of Antigua, Barbados and St. Lucia. In 1997 he received the title of Jerusalem Pilgrim from Israel's Ministry of Tourism. He is the husband of Johanna and the father of two daughters, Victoria Sarah and Gloria Elizabeth.

A fresh way to experience the Bible! 290 down-to-earth poems, based on Bible passages, range from traditional rhyme to free verse, and speak in a personal voice to the reader. The applicable Bible verses are listed with each poem. Blank pages and wide margins provide space to creatively respond with thoughts, prayers, poems, sketches, and doodles. Looking for a new approach to Bible reading? For readers of the Bible as well as those who shy away from reading the Bible. Bible Poems for Reflection and Response offers a personal and interactive way to experience the enduring truths of God's Word. Not sure if you're a poetry person? These poems are accessible--no obscure poetic language, no hidden meanings. They range from traditional rhyme to haiku to free verse. There is something for everyone, and yet you will find that the poems seem to speak personally to you. You don't have to read in sequence. Jump around if you like. Read a poem every day, or twice a day, or once a week. This is your book to read and to interpret as you like. You can read the Bible verses suggested (and beyond) or simply the poems--or both. Personalize your reading experience. Space is provided with interspersed blank pages and with wide margins--to respond to what you're reading and feeling. By adding your thoughts, prayers, reflections, poems, drawings, and doodles, this book will truly become a conversation between you and God.

The attention of audiences have been captivated by rhythm and rhyme. Who has not appreciated the works of Dr. Seuss or listening to poems that mimic The Night Before Christmas? Imagine if the Bible, Gods Word, were put into that format. Would that not also capture attention? Read the following excerpt about the circumstances surrounding the death of Lazarus. Read it slowly and with care. 11:20 When the word had come to Martha That Jesus was coming by, While Mary stayed inside the home, She went out to ask Him why. 11:21 Lord, if You had been here on time, My brother would not have died, 11:22 But I still know that God will give Whatever You ask, she cried. 11:23 Your brother, He said, will rise again. She replied without question, 11:24 I know hell rise on the last day, In the resurrection. 11:25 Im the resurrection and life, To her was His reply. He who believes in Me will live, Even if he should die. 11:26 And everyone who is alive, And in Me their faith does cleave, These ones will never, ever die. Is this what you believe? This book is the beginning work of putting Gods Word to rhythm and rhyme. Enjoy the writings of the apostle John as you have read before but to the beat of a drum and to a sound that will impact your heart.
